Overview Moxate CV 500mg/125mg Tablet
This antibiotic medication, Moxate CV 500mg/125mg Tablet, combats bacterial infections. Its applications include treating respiratory infections (like pneumonia), ear, sinus, urinary tract, skin, and soft tissue infections. It's ineffective against viral illnesses such as the common cold. For optimal absorption and reduced stomach discomfort, take Moxate CV with food, adhering strictly to your doctor's prescribed schedule for consistent dosing. Complete the entire course of treatment, even if symptoms improve; premature discontinuation risks infection recurrence or worsening. The medication's dosage varies depending on the infection being treated. Common, generally mild, side effects may include nausea, diarrhea, vomiting, oral or vaginal thrush, skin rashes, and vaginitis. Report any persistent or bothersome side effects to your physician. Prior to commencing treatment, disclose any antibiotic allergies, kidney or liver issues, and all other medications you're currently using to your doctor, as interactions are possible. While generally safe for pregnant and breastfeeding individuals under medical supervision, always consult your doctor before use.

How Moxate CV 500mg/125mg Tablet works:
Each Moxate CV 500mg/125mg tablet unites amoxicillin, a bacterial growth inhibitor, with clavulanic acid, a beta-lactamase inhibitor. Amoxicillin functions by disrupting bacterial cell wall synthesis, a vital process for bacterial survival. Clavulanic acid counteracts bacterial resistance mechanisms, thereby boosting amoxicillin's effectiveness.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holSAFE
Ingestion of alcohol alongside Moxate CV 500mg/125mg tablets presents no known adverse reactions.
PregnancySAFE IF PRESCRIBED
The use of Moxate CV 500mg/125mg tablets during pregnancy is typically deemed safe. Preclinical trials in animals revealed minimal or absent harm to offspring; nevertheless, clinical data from human trials are scarce.
Breast feedingSAFE IF PRESCRIBED
Lactating individuals may safely use Moxate CV 500mg/125mg tablets. Research in humans indicates minimal drug transfer to breast milk, posing no known risk to the infant.
DrivingUNSAFE
Driving ability may be impaired by Moxate CV 500mg/125mg Tablets, due to potential side effects including allergic reactions, dizziness, or seizures.
KidneyCAUTION
Patients with impaired kidney function should use Moxate CV 500mg/125mg Tablets cautiously, potentially requiring a modified dosage. Physician consultation is advised. This medication is contraindicated in individuals with severe kidney disease.
LiverCAUTION
Patients with liver impairment should exercise caution when using Moxate CV 500mg/125mg tablets. Dosage modification may be necessary; physician consultation is advised. Liver function should be regularly assessed during treatment.
What if you forget to take Moxate CV 500mg/125mg Tablet :
Should you forget to take a Moxate CV 500mg/125mg Tablet, administer it at your earliest convenience.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ed tablet and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.
